Transaction 59d1f6c8e4304102b7033217ea1709e47fe5a728352832da71ce11f941479c70
2 Input
2 Outputs
- 59d1f6c8e4304102b7033217ea1709e47fe5a728352832da71ce11f941479c70:0
- 59d1f6c8e4304102b7033217ea1709e47fe5a728352832da71ce11f941479c70:1
value 4115
address 1CsEURgzYZHayfDavngcUHJ1Lkm7uLVEs
value 12251
address 12xWbZFw8JwA3UMm994oVAM5outC4Fn99J